Membrane fouling remains a major obstacle in liquid-based membrane processes, which restricts widespread applications of membrane-based processes. Approaches for membrane fouling control have been reported, including development of spacers. Typically, a spacer is required to provide a flow channel for the feed and permeate, to induce local mixing, and more recently to facilitate membrane fouling control. Those critical roles of a spacer could be enhanced by improving spacer design and geometry as discussed in the present paper. This study provides a comprehensive review on recent development of spacers incorporated in the plate-and-frame as well as in the spiral wound modules (SWMs), particularly on the spacer roles in membrane fouling control. The hydraulic performances of filtration systems incorporating new spacer along with the spacer’s impacts against biofouling are extensively discussed …
